1. The Basic Conversion: 150 mm to Inches



Q: What is the fundamental relationship between millimeters and inches?

A: The fundamental relationship lies in the conversion factor. One inch is precisely equal to 25.4 millimeters. This means that for every 25.4 millimeters, there is one inch. This conversion factor is universally accepted and is the basis for all calculations involving these two units.

Q: How do we convert 150 mm to inches?

A: To convert 150 mm to inches, we use the conversion factor:

1 inch = 25.4 mm

We can set up a proportion:

1 inch / 25.4 mm = x inches / 150 mm

Solving for x (the number of inches):

x = (150 mm 1 inch) / 25.4 mm = 5.9055 inches (approximately)

Therefore, 150 mm is approximately 5.91 inches.


2. Understanding Significant Figures and Precision



Q: Why is the answer approximately 5.91 inches, and not a longer decimal?

A: The precision of our answer depends on the number of significant figures in the original measurement (150 mm). While the conversion factor (25.4 mm) is highly precise, our input of 150 mm implies a precision of only three significant figures. Therefore, rounding our calculated value to 5.91 inches is appropriate to maintain consistency in the precision level. Using more decimal places would imply a greater accuracy than our initial measurement allows.

5. Expanding on Conversions: Centimeters and Other Units



Q: How would you convert 150 mm to centimeters or other units?

A: Since 10 millimeters equal 1 centimeter, converting 150 mm to centimeters is straightforward:

150 mm / 10 mm/cm = 15 cm

To convert to other units, such as feet or yards, you would simply use the appropriate conversion factors:

1 inch = 2.54 cm
1 foot = 12 inches
1 yard = 3 feet

FAQs



1. Q: What if I have a measurement in inches and need to convert it to millimeters? Simply reverse the process. Multiply the measurement in inches by 25.4 to get the equivalent in millimeters.

2. Q: Can I use a different conversion factor for inches to millimeters? While variations might exist due to rounding, using 25.4 mm per inch is the most accurate and universally accepted conversion factor.

3. Q: How do I handle conversions with more complex measurements, such as volume or area? Conversion for volume or area requires cubing or squaring the linear conversion factor, respectively. For instance, to convert cubic millimeters to cubic inches, you'd cube 25.4.

4. Q: What are the potential sources of error in conversions? Errors can arise from using inaccurate conversion factors, incorrect significant figures, or calculation mistakes. Using online calculators and double-checking your work minimizes these errors.

5. Q: Why are both metric and imperial systems still used? Both systems have historical roots and continue to be used in different parts of the world. While the metric system is internationally preferred for scientific and most industrial applications, the imperial system remains prevalent in some countries, leading to the ongoing need for conversions.
